galleria Corno di Cavento
galleria Corno di Cavento is a cave in Valdaone, Trentino, Trentino-Alto Adige. galleria Corno di Cavento is situated nearby to the peak La Bottiglia, as well as near the mountain saddle Passo di Cavento.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Corno di Cavento
Peak
The Corno di Cavento is a mountain in Trentino-Alto Adige, Italy. It is located in the Province of Trento, between Val Rendena and Val di Fumo. Its summit was conquered for the first time by a young Bohemian climber, Julius von Payer, along with Coronna, Gries and Hayer, on 3 September 1868.
Carè Alto
Peak

Carè Alto is a mountain in the Italian Alps, near Trento, above the San Valentino valley. It has a summit elevation of 3,463 m. It is a mountain of the Adamello-Presanella Group in the provinces of Trentino and Brescia and is part of the Southern Limestone Alps. Carè Alto is situated 3 km south of galleria Corno di Cavento.
